Appropriate Preposition:

  • Triumph over ( জয় করা ) Jim and Della triumphed over their poverty.
  • Proportionate to ( আনুপাতিক ) Punishment should be proportionate to offence.
  • True to ( বিশ্বস্ত ) He is true to his master.
  • Deprived of ( বঞ্চিত ) He was deprived of his property.
  • Officiate for ( পরিবর্তে কাজ করা (ব্যক্তি) ) He officiated for me in that post.
  • Prone to ( ঝোঁক আছে এমন ) He is prone to idleness.

Idioms:

  • Curry favour ( তোষামোদ করিয়ে প্রিয় হওয়া ) He knows how to curry favour with officers.
  • Chip of the old block ( বাপকা বেটা ) He is a chip of the old black.
  • Irony of fate ( ভাগ্যের পরিহাস ) He could not succeed by irony of fate.
  • Hard and fast ( বাঁধা ধরা ) There is no such hard and fast rule in this matter.
  • Three R's ( প্রাথমিক শিক্ষা ) The majority of our people have not yet learnt the three R's.
  • Dead language ( যে ভাষা এখন আর কথ্য নয় ) Sanskrit is a rich language, but it is now a dead language.
